Laser Cutting Demonstration and Training Session
Join us in the makerspace for a demonstration and training on the GlowForge Pro laser cutter. The Glowforge laser cutter is a versatile desktop device that uses a laser to cut, engrave, and score a variety of materials such as wood, acrylic, leather, fabric, and more. - Attendees will learn how to design a file for successful engraving/cutting using Google Slides, Photopea, or the Glowforge’s native design environment and how to safely and sustainably operate the Glowforge Pro laser engraver.
- For more information on how you can be successful operating the Glowforge and for a list of approved materials take a look at our Getting Started Guide.
- Upon completion of this training, attendees will be certified to reserve and use the equipment through our Library Calendar website.
----------------- Age Requirements - All patrons, 10 and up should sign up individually. Registration is required for all active and passive participants.
- Children under the age of 10 are not allowed in the space.
- Youth between 10-16 may use the space under the direct supervision of a parent/guardian who has completed a training session with the Makerspace staff. Limit one youth per Adult.

Custom Design Demonstration and Training Session
Join us in the makerspace for a demonstration and training on sublimation and vinyl cutting, with special attention to Cricut and Brother equipment. Attendees will gain an exposure for how the Cricut cutting machine can take digital designs created in the Cricut Design Space and print/cut their project onto sticker paper, vinyl, and other soft materials. For more information on how you can be successful using the Cricut take a look at our Getting Started Guide.
After this… - Attendees will learn about the art of Sublimation which uses heat to transfer graphics, like the ones taken with your phone, and transfer them to ‘blanks’ such as tee shirts, puzzles, mugs, and wood.
